what is a trail maid

A trail maid usually refers to an Azalea Trail Maid – a high school senior girl chosen to serve as an official ambassador and hostess for the city of Mobile, Alabama, in the United States.

Quick Scoop: What is a Trail Maid?

  • Trail Maids (formally Azalea Trail Maids) are 50 selected high school seniors who represent Mobile, Alabama, at parades, festivals, and civic events.
  • They wear large, pastel, hoop-skirted gowns inspired by antebellum fashion, along with matching bonnets, gloves, and parasols.
  • Their role is to symbolize Southern hospitality, youth leadership, and community pride while welcoming visitors and answering questions about Mobile’s history and attractions.

What Do Trail Maids Actually Do?

Trail Maids are not just “girls in big dresses” – they have a structured ambassador role.

They typically:

  1. Appear at events
    • Greet tourists, dignitaries, and cruise ship visitors.
 * Participate in city parades and sometimes national events like major holiday parades.
  1. Serve as cultural ambassadors
    • Share facts about Mobile’s history, landmarks, and traditions (including the Azalea Trail and local Mardi Gras).
 * Present a polished public image of the city through etiquette, poise, and public speaking.
  1. Maintain high standards
    • Are selected through a rigorous process that looks at grades, interviews, community service, and communication skills.
 * Commit to a year-long schedule of appearances and ambassador duties during their senior year.

How Do You Become a Trail Maid?

The path is competitive and structured.

Typical steps:

  1. Eligibility & interest
    • You’re a high school junior in Mobile County who will serve during senior year.
  1. Application process
    • Submit forms, essays, and recommendations through your school or local organizations.
  1. Interviews and testing
    • Go through multiple interview rounds at school and county levels.
 * Demonstrate knowledge of Mobile’s history, current events, and local attractions, along with poise and personality.
  1. Selection & roles
    • Fifty girls are chosen as Azalea Trail Maids; within them, special titles like Queen and Ladies‑in‑Waiting are named.
 * Each receives a custom gown in one of several pastel colors.

Why Are Trail Maids Trending Lately?

In recent years, Trail Maids have gained fresh attention on social platforms:

  • Short videos and clips of their huge pastel dresses and coordinated appearances have gone viral, especially on TikTok.
  • Online viewers are curious about what they do, how heavy the dresses are, and what the selection process is like.

At the same time, there’s ongoing discussion:

  • Some celebrate the tradition as a showcase of youth achievement, public service, and local pride.
  • Others criticize the antebellum-inspired costumes as evoking an era tied to slavery and racial oppression, especially when the group appears at high-profile national events.

This mix of admiration and critique keeps “Trail Maids” an active topic in forum and social media discussions about tradition, representation, and modernizing historic imagery.
